- The distance between Thumrait, Oman and Bunkie, La, Usa is approximately 13,513 km or 8,397 mi.
- To reach Thumrait in this distance one would set out from Bunkie, La bearing 38.4°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Thumrait bearing 146° or SE .
- Thumrait has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Bunkie, La has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Thumrait is in or near the tropical desert biome whereas Bunkie, La is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 7.1 °C (12.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.6 °C (10.1°F) less in Thumrait.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1519.1 mm (59.8 in) less which is equivalent to 1519.1 l/m² (37.28 US gal/ft²) or 15,191,000 l/ha (1,624,019 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.5° higher in Thumrait than in Bunkie, La.
